3 Theory of Elasticity - Hooke s law (σ = E ε ) - the effect of transformations in stress distribution is considered only in stability check - material will break, when the stress is equal with the strength - stress distribution has no effect on the strength of material - designing is simple Reality - Hooke s law is valid when stresses are relatively small - Young s modulus differ in tension and in compress - material will become plastic before breaking 3
4 Loaded wood behaves as viscoelastic material Deformations of loaded wood increase in time, wood creeps! The strength will decrease and the deformations will increase with increasing moisture (absolut humidity of wood 0 30%) in analysis the strength and stiffness values are adjusted according to the relative humidity of conditions and duration of loads with factors k mod and k def 4

6 Strength grading of timber The strength of timber vary Visual grading: - number, location and quality of knots, the most important parameter (~90%) - cracking, twisting, skewness - density, proportion of latewood Mechanical grading: - bending test (+visual) - Young modulus (of elasticity) 6
7 Strength grading of timber Test conditions in eurocode: 300s, T=20 C, RH65% Strength varies distribution of values: - the value for analysis in ultimate limit state is the lower 5% fractile of strength distribution - example graph: distribution of tension strength in grades (a), (b) ja (c) 7

9 Quality grading of timber Don t mix with strength grading! Quality grading is based on exterior features of timber: - knots, cracks, wanies, resin and bark pockets or wounds, angle grains, grown breaks, compression wood, soft rot and wrong shapes I - VI (first sixth grade) or A(A1-A4) -D (scandinavian) 9
10 Strength of timber Strength grades (pine, spruce): - EC grades: C14,C16,C18,C20,C22,C24, C27,C30,C35,C40,C45,C50 - Finnish grades (old): visual T18,T24,T30,T40 mechanical MT18,,MT40 - Scandinavian INSTA 142 T-grading: T1,T2,T3 (= C18,C24,C30) 10

15 Glued Laminated Timber According to EC386 the laminated timber sheets are usually 45 or 33mm thick, at least 4 sheets! The timber has to be strength graded The glues (resorcinol-pfenol, melamine) are weather proof (except polyurethane) 15
16 Glued Laminated Timber Scandinavian strength grading: L30, L40 EC: GL28c,GL28h,GL32c,GL32h, h = homogeneous timber c = combination of different strength grades in cross section, see below Example L40 (~ EC: GL32c) 16

25 Service classes Service classes are aimed to assign strength and stiffness values to defined conditions (humidity, temperature) Especially humidity has a great effect on strength and stiffness values of wood Wood is hygroscopic, there is always moisture equilibrium between wood and ambient moisture. E.g. moisture equilibrium of spruce 25
26 Service classes Chart. Moisture of wood ( average percent of moisture in wood, mass of water/mass of wood ) and corresponding relative humidity (RH) of air in 20 C temperature in different service classes. The limits can be exceeded for few weeks in a year. Service class EC5 Relative Humidity (of air) Moisture of wood 1 <65% < 12 % 2 <85% < 20 % 3 >85% >20% 26
27 Description of service classes Service class Descriptions of service classes, examples 1 Heated interiors and structures in insulation layers covering also beams, whose cross section under tension is in insulation layer. 2 Roofed (covered) exteriors, dry wooden structures located outside. 3 Uncovered wooden structures, e.g. structures outside in rain. 27
28 Load-duration classes Wood can bear substantial shortterm loads, but can break under considerably smaller long-term loads. Displacements will also increase in time. 28
29 Load-duration classes Description Permanent: > 10 years Long-term: 6 months - 10 years Middle-term: 1 week - 6 months Short-term: < 1 week Instantaneous Example Self-weight light interior walls soil pressure Stored goods water tanks Snow (surface) live load (classes A-D,F,G) Live load in stairs (point) live load installation loads horizontal loads of interior walls and rails Wind, accidental loads 29
30 Load-duration classes Load-duration class of a load combinations is selected according to the shortest duration in combination. Load combination, examples Self-weight of structures (Sw) Sw + (surface) live load (A-D) Sw + snow Sw + live load in stairs Sw + snow + wind Sw + wind Load-duration class Permanent Middle-term Middle-term Short-term Instantaneous Instantaneous It is important to find the most determining combination in analysis, and sometimes we need to analyse several different combinations to achieve this goal! 30
